Tar and chip driveway paving is a practical surface treatment that involves applying a layer of hot tar or asphalt followed by spreading small, chipped stones over the top. Once the stones are pressed into the tar, the surface is rolled to create a durable, textured finish. This method provides a cost-effective alternative to traditional asphalt or concrete paving, offering a rustic appearance that can complement many residential properties. It is a relatively straightforward process that can be completed quickly, making it a popular choice for homeowners seeking a functional and attractive driveway upgrade.

This paving service helps address common driveway problems such as erosion, cracking, and uneven surfaces. Over time, weather conditions and regular use can cause driveways to deteriorate, leading to safety hazards and increased maintenance costs. Tar and chip paving offers a resilient surface that can withstand heavy loads and resist the effects of moisture, reducing the likelihood of potholes and surface degradation. Additionally, the textured finish provides good traction, which can help prevent slipping during rainy or icy conditions, making it a practical choice for homes in areas with variable weather.

What is tar and chip driveway paving? Tar and chip driveway paving involves applying a layer of hot liquid asphalt followed by a layer of aggregate stones to create a durable and textured surface for driveways.

How does tar and chip paving compare to asphalt? Tar and chip paving typically offers a more textured and rustic appearance, while asphalt provides a smoother surface; both are durable options handled by local contractors.

Is tar and chip paving suitable for residential driveways? Yes, tar and chip paving is often used for residential driveways, providing a cost-effective and visually appealing surface when installed by local service providers.

What are common materials used in tar and chip driveway paving? The process generally uses hot asphalt as the binder and various sizes of aggregate stones, selected based on the desired texture and durability.

Can tar and chip paving be repaired or resealed? Yes, local contractors can perform repairs or resealing to maintain the appearance and functionality of a tar and chip driveway over time.
